Understand Chinese Nickname

余生未了庸人自扰

[yú shēng wèi le yōng rén zì răo]
Interpreting 'Yu Sheng Wei Liao Yong Ren Zi Rao': It means something left undone in remaining life and a common man troubles himself needlessly. In short, this expresses self-reflection or regret over unfinished tasks, and anxiety brought upon oneself without any real necessity during rest of his life.
Generate Chinese Nickname
Relation Nicknames